Support TLS extensions (specifically, HostName)
[openssl.git] / crypto / symhacks.h
index 40237178d96b10c9073c572ca5c1f695059ee529..db91bc562da9f0295cf7acdb7b39c86bf48932dd 100644 (file)
 #define X509_policy_tree_get0_user_policies    X509_pcy_tree_get0_usr_policies
 #undef X509_policy_node_get0_qualifiers
 #define X509_policy_node_get0_qualifiers       X509_pcy_node_get0_qualifiers
+#undef X509_STORE_CTX_get_explicit_policy
+#define X509_STORE_CTX_get_explicit_policy     X509_STORE_CTX_get_expl_policy
 
 /* Hack some long CRYPTO names */
 #undef CRYPTO_set_dynlock_destroy_callback
 
 
 /* Case insensiteve linking causes problems.... */
-#if defined(OPENSSL_SYS_WIN16) || defined(OPENSSL_SYS_VMS) || defined(OPENSSL_SYS_OS2)
+#if defined(OPENSSL_SYS_VMS) || defined(OPENSSL_SYS_OS2)
 #undef ERR_load_CRYPTO_strings
 #define ERR_load_CRYPTO_strings                        ERR_load_CRYPTOlib_strings
 #undef OCSP_crlID_new